Transaction ff91e3f4deaa99ca63aff4eaa6b5691cd4dd3e29a05b2ddfc401669955564b76
1 Input
1 Output
-
ff91e3f4deaa99ca63aff4eaa6b5691cd4dd3e29a05b2ddfc401669955564b76:0
- value
- 525831
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4de0bda651c38e69ecd1a4efe8f97eb060e21157 OP_EQUALVERIFY OP_CHECKSIG
- address
- 186nG38pKoKjbUX5PGLRAgeoPe4fkXBXJK